Hi,

My almost brand new M10 is spot-on with my brand-new 28mm/2, the 35mm FLE & the 50mm/1.4 ASPH.

So far, this is what I had with the M9 & the M240 except the M10 seems even better.

 

But the 90mm/2.8 shows some front-focus: 3 cm at 1 meter & also around the infinite. I had both the body & lens checked in a reputable shop and as expected, the M10 is perfect but the lens is "within the margin of error"...

 

So I checked with 2 other 90mm, both Apo-ASPH, one of them new and both showed some strong front focus: 2 to 3 meter at 20 meter for instance.

 

I plan to investigate some more but so far, I'm puzzled (as is the shop & my usual reseller). What can make a Leica M precise with all the lenses but consistently exhibit front-focus with 3 different 90mm?

 

Any idea?
